diff --git a/drivers/net/wan/hdlc_fr.c b/drivers/net/wan/hdlc_fr.c index 78596e4..425a47f 100644 --- a/drivers/net/wan/hdlc_fr.c +++ b/drivers/net/wan/hdlc_fr.c @@ -1003,11 +1003,10 @@ static void fr_start(struct net_device *dev) state(hdlc)->n391cnt = 0; state(hdlc)->txseq = state(hdlc)->rxseq = 0; - init_timer(&state(hdlc)->timer); + setup_timer(&state(hdlc)->timer, fr_timer, + (unsigned long)dev); /* First poll after 1 s */ state(hdlc)->timer.expires = jiffies + HZ; - state(hdlc)->timer.function = fr_timer; - state(hdlc)->timer.data = (unsigned long)dev; add_timer(&state(hdlc)->timer); } else fr_set_link_state(1, dev);
Use setup_timer function instead of initializing timer with the function and data fields. Signed-off-by: Allen Pais <allen.lkml@gmail.com> --- drivers/net/wan/hdlc_fr.c | 5 ++--- 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
